Is Banksy Robin Gunningham?
The question of Banksy’s real name has been asked for more than two decades. The most persistent answer points to Robin Gunningham, a man born in Bristol in 1974. The BBC reported in 2021 that Banksy was born Robin Gunningham and later took the name David Jones. Reuters, in a 2026 investigation, also identified Gunningham as the artist behind the stencils.
What Is the Evidence Linking Banksy to Robin Gunningham?
The evidence is circumstantial but substantial. Researchers have mapped Banksy’s known movements against Gunningham’s known addresses and found correlations. Former schoolmates and associates have described Gunningham as the artist. A 2016 study by academics at Queen Mary University of London used geographic profiling to predict Gunningham’s home locations based on where Banksy’s works appeared. The study’s results pointed to a pub in Bristol and a residential address linked to Gunningham.
Has Banksy’s Identity Been Officially Confirmed?
No. Banksy has never publicly confirmed his identity. The artist has maintained anonymity for decades, and no official statement, press release, or public appearance has ever verified the claims made by journalists or researchers. The BBC has noted that despite extensive reporting, Banksy himself has not commented on the matter.
How Does Banksy Remain Anonymous?
Banksy operates through intermediaries, uses a tight circle of trusted collaborators, and rarely appears in public without disguise. His official website, banksy.co.uk, is minimalist and offers no biographical information. Pest Control, the authentication body, acts as a gatekeeper for all official communications. The artist’s Instagram account, @banksy, posts new works but never reveals the artist’s face or voice.

What Is the Meaning of the Girl with Balloon?
Girl with Balloon, first stencilled on a wall in London, shows a young girl reaching toward a red heart-shaped balloon. It is often interpreted as a symbol of hope, love, or the loss of innocence. In 2018, the work was shredded by a hidden mechanism in its frame moments after selling for £1 million at Sotheby’s. The shredded piece was renamed Love is in the Bin and later sold for £18.6 million at a subsequent auction. The Hollywood Reporter noted that the stunt helped make Banksy one of the world’s most commercially valuable and culturally influential contemporary artists.

What Are the Controversies and Legal Issues Surrounding Banksy?
Is Banksy’s Work Vandalism?
Banksy’s street art is created without permission on both public and private property. This has led to ongoing debates about whether the work constitutes vandalism or public art. Some property owners have painted over Banksy’s murals, while others have sold them for large sums. The legal status of each piece depends on local laws and the property owner’s response.
What Is Pest Control?
Pest Control is the only official body that can issue a Certificate of Authenticity for Banksy’s work. The organisation acts as the artist’s legal and administrative representative. Pest Control’s website states that Banksy is not on Facebook, Twitter, or represented by any other gallery. This strict control helps prevent forgeries and maintains the integrity of the artist’s output.
Has Banksy Ever Been Sued?
Banksy has been involved in several legal disputes, most notably over copyright. In one case, the artist fought to retain control of his image after a greeting card company used his work without permission. The European Union Intellectual Property Office ruled in 2020 that Banksy could not keep his trademark on the Flower Thrower image because he had not used it commercially. To protect his rights, Banksy opened a pop-up shop called Gross Domestic Product to sell branded merchandise.

What Is the Banksy Timeline?
- Early 1990s – Banksy begins graffiti work in Bristol’s street art scene. (Source: Wikipedia)
- 2002 – First major exhibition ‘Turf War’ in London. (Source: Britannica)
- 2005 – ‘Barely Legal’ exhibition in Los Angeles featuring the ‘Elephant in the Room’. (Source: Britannica)
- 2010 – Directs the documentary ‘Exit Through the Gift Shop’, nominated for an Academy Award. (Source: Wikipedia)
- 2018 – Shreds ‘Girl with Balloon’ immediately after it sells for £1 million at Sotheby’s, creating ‘Love is in the Bin’. (Source: Hollywood Reporter)
- 2019 – ‘Devolved Parliament’ painting sells for nearly £9.9 million, a record for Banksy. (Source: BBC)
- 2021 – BBC reports Banksy’s real name is Robin Gunningham, who took the name David Jones. (Source: BBC News)
- 2024 – Sets up a stall at the Venice Biennale to sell authentic Banksy works for £60. (Source: The Guardian)

Why Does Banksy’s Anonymity Drive So Much Interest?
The anonymity of Banksy drives immense media and market value. By wrapping the art in a layer of mystery and anti-establishment narrative, the absence of a known identity becomes a feature, not a flaw. The Britannica entry on Banksy notes that the artist’s refusal to reveal himself keeps the public’s attention fixed on the work itself.
The commodification of anti-capitalist street art creates a paradox that Banksy actively engages with. The shredding stunt at Sotheby’s is the clearest example: a work that critiques the art market was sold in that same market for a record price. Banksy’s work also acts as a global barometer of political sentiment, with pieces frequently appearing in conflict zones and protest sites.
